linux怎样复制文件命令
-
在Linux系统中,复制文件的命令是”cp”。下面是关于使用”cp”命令复制文件的详细步骤:
1. 打开终端:在Linux系统中,打开终端是执行命令的前提。
2. 确定源文件和目标文件的路径:在执行复制文件的命令前,需要先确定源文件和目标文件的路径。源文件是要复制的文件,目标文件是复制后生成的文件。
3. 使用”cp”命令复制文件:在终端中输入以下命令来复制文件:
“`
cp [选项] 源文件 目标文件
“`
其中,”cp”表示复制命令,”[选项]”是一些可选参数,”源文件”是要复制的文件的路径,”目标文件”是复制后生成的文件的路径。例如,要将文件”file.txt”复制到一个名为”backup”的文件夹中,可以使用以下命令:
“`
cp file.txt backup/
“`4. 确认文件已复制:执行复制命令后,系统不会显示任何提示信息。为了确认文件已经成功复制,可以使用”ls”命令来查看目标文件所在的目录,确认目标文件已经生成。
需要注意的是,在复制文件时,如果目标文件已经存在,系统会提示是否覆盖目标文件。如果要强制覆盖目标文件,可以使用”-f”选项,如下所示:
“`
cp -f file.txt backup/
“`此外,还可以使用其他一些选项来改变复制文件的行为,例如:
– “-r”选项:递归复制目录及其内容;
– “-i”选项:在复制文件前显示提示信息;
– “-u”选项:仅复制源文件新于目标文件或目标文件不存在的文件。以上就是在Linux系统中使用”cp”命令复制文件的方法。希望对你有帮助!
2年前 -
在Linux中,有几种方法可以复制文件。下面是一些常用的命令行方式:
1. 使用cp命令:cp是一个用于复制文件和目录的命令。它的基本语法如下:
`cp 源文件 目标文件`
例如,要将文件`file1.txt`复制到另一个文件`file2.txt`,可以执行以下命令:
`cp file1.txt file2.txt`2. 复制目录:如果要复制整个目录及其内容,可以使用`-r`选项来递归地复制目录和子目录:
`cp -r 源目录 目标目录`
例如,要将整个目录`dir1`复制到目录`dir2`中,可以使用以下命令:
`cp -r dir1 dir2`3. 使用rsync命令:rsync是一个功能强大的文件同步工具,可以在本地和远程系统之间复制文件。它的基本语法如下:
`rsync 选项 源文件 目标文件`
例如,要将本地文件`file.txt`复制到远程服务器的目录`/path/to/directory`,可以使用以下命令:
`rsync file.txt user@remotehost:/path/to/directory`4. 使用scp命令:scp是一个安全拷贝命令,用于在本地主机和远程主机之间复制文件。它的基本语法如下:
`scp 源文件 目标文件`
例如,要将本地文件`file.txt`复制到远程主机的目录`/path/to/directory`,可以使用以下命令:
`scp file.txt user@remotehost:/path/to/directory`5. 复制到剪贴板:有时候我们想将文件内容复制到剪贴板中,可以使用`xclip`命令。首先,需要安装`xclip`包。然后可以使用以下命令将文件内容复制到剪贴板:
`cat 文件名 | xclip -selection clipboard`
例如,将文件`myfile.txt`的内容复制到剪贴板:
`cat myfile.txt | xclip -selection clipboard`这些是Linux中常用的文件复制命令。根据需要,可以选择适合的方法来实现文件复制。
2年前 -
在Linux系统中,有多种方法可以复制文件。以下是其中的一些常见方法和操作流程:
1. 使用cp命令复制文件:
`cp`。 示例:
`cp file1.txt file2.txt` – 将file1.txt文件复制到当前目录下并命名为file2.txt。若要复制目录及其所有文件和子目录,可以在命令中加入`-r`选项:
`cp -r`。 示例:
`cp -r directory1 directory2` – 将directory1目录及其所有内容复制到当前目录下并命名为directory2。2. 使用rsync命令复制文件:
`rsync`。 rsync命令提供了更多的选项和功能,例如可以进行增量备份,只复制更新的文件等。
示例:
`rsync -a file1.txt file2.txt` – 将file1.txt复制到当前目录下并命名为file2.txt,保留文件的属性和权限。若要复制目录及其所有文件和子目录,同样可以加入`-r`选项。
3. 使用scp命令在不同主机之间复制文件:
`scp@ : `。 示例:
`scp file1.txt user@192.168.0.1:/home/user/` – 将file1.txt复制到远程主机192.168.0.1的/home/user/目录下。若要复制目录及其所有内容,同样需要加入`-r`选项。
4. 使用mv命令复制文件(不推荐):
`mv`。 mv命令用于移动文件,但是当目的地路径与源路径不在同一文件系统中时,mv命令将执行复制操作。但是使用mv命令复制文件可能导致文件被覆盖,容易出错,不推荐使用。
以上是常见的几种方法复制文件的操作流程。根据实际情况选择最适合自己需求的方法。
2年前